2011 Member's Day & AGM
CILIP West Midlands invite you to join us for our 2011 Members' Day and AGM. Hosted at Staffordshire University Thompson Library (Stoke Campus) on Wednesday 30th March, the theme of the day is "New libraries: new challenges".
Featuring presentations from a number of exciting library projects across the region, we will explore some of the challenges of libraries of the future. There will also be the opportunity to take a tour of Staffordshire University's current library during the lunch break.
The afternoon session will be opened by CILIP Vice President, Phil Bradley.
In addition to the CILIP West Midlands branch AGM and presentation of certificates, we will be joined by the West Midlands division of CILIP Career Development Group and CILIP Colleges of Further and Higher Education for their AGMs. We would also like to hear what you would like the branch to do for you over the next year, and there will be plenty of opportunity to share your views during the day.
